*{margin:0;padding:0;}
li{padding:0;margin:0;}
ul{padding:0;margin:0;}
li{list-style:none;}
span,p{font-family:"微软雅黑";font-family:微软雅黑;}
a{text-decoration:none;font-family:"微软雅黑";font-family:微软雅黑;}
a:hover{text-decoration: none;}
input,select,option,textarea{outline: none;}
.clear{clear:both;}
body {font-family: "微软雅黑";font-family:微软雅黑;color:#000; margin: 0;padding: 0;}
img{margin:0px;padding:0px;border:none;}


body{
	background: url(./ztjytou.png) no-repeat top center;
}

#bt{
	width: 1260px;text-align:center;margin:0 auto;margin-top:430px;line-height:200%;
}

#bt a{
	color:#E4241F;font-size:34px;font-weight:bold;text-align:center;
}
#tspan{
	width:1260px;font-size:16px;color:#666666;text-align:center;line-height:200%;display: block;margin-top:15px;
}
#showl{
	width:1230px;margin:0 auto;height: 500px;margin-top:25px;
}
#sleft{
	float:left;width: 677px;height:466px;background: url(./lunbg.png);
}
#sright{
	float:right;
	width:524px;
}
#slun{
		width:655px;
		height:370px;margin-top:11px;margin-left:11px;
		position:relative;
		cursor:pointer;
			transition:all 0.4s ease;
	-o-transition:all 0.4s ease;
	-ms-transition:all 0.4s ease;
	-moz-transition:all 0.4s ease;
	-webkit-transition:all 0.4s ease;
		}

#imglist{
width:100%;
height:100%;
}

#imglist li{
width:100%;
height:100%;
}

#slun img{
width:100%;
height:100%;
display:block;
}
#listnum2>li{display:none;}
#listnum2>.activenum{display:block;}


#listnum3>li{display:none;}
#listnum3>.activenum{display:block;}


#slun>ul>li{
opacity:0;
transition:opacity .5s linear;
position:absolute;	z-index:0;
}
#imglist2>li{height:338px;display:none;}

#imglist2>.active{display:block;}
#imglist3>li{height:338px;display:none;}

#imglist3>.active{display:block;}
#slun>ul>.active{
opacity:1;
z-index:1;
}

#listnum{
width:100%;
height:42px;
position:absolute;
bottom:-65px;
left:0px;
z-index:3;
}

#slistulfixd{
width:100px;float:right;
}
#listnum>ul>li{
width:15px;
height:15px;
border-radius:5px;
float:left;
margin-top:15px;
margin-left:10px;
}

#listnum>ul>li>i{
display:block;
width:10px;height:10px;
margin:0 auto;
border-radius:4px;
margin-top:1px;background:#E3B88A;
}

#listnum>ul>li>a{
color:#E4241F;
bottom:10px;left:5px;font-size:16px;
position:absolute;
display:none;
}

#listnum>ul>.activenum >i{
background:#FD201D;
}
#listnum>ul>.activenum >a{
display:block;
width:70%;
overflow: hidden; white-space: nowrap; text-overflow: ellipsis;
}
#sright ul{margin-top:0px;}
#sright ul li{
	display: block;width: 100%;border-bottom:1px solid #E2E2E2;height:60px;margin-bottom:5px;background:url(./lunsj.png) no-repeat left 27px;
}
#sright ul li a{
	font-size:18px;color:#333333;line-height:60px;display:block;width:85%;padding-left: 13px;
			overflow: hidden; white-space: nowrap; text-overflow: ellipsis;transition:all 0.4s ease;
	-o-transition:all 0.4s ease;
	-ms-transition:all 0.4s ease;
	-moz-transition:all 0.4s ease;
	-webkit-transition:all 0.4s ease;
}
.xindongshow{width:1280px;margin:0 auto;margin-top:40px;}
.xdl{
	float:left;width:600px;height:338px;position:relative;
}
.xdl img{display: block;width:100%;height:100%;}
.xdlas{width: 100%;height:50px;background:#D10F01;line-height:50px;position:absolute;bottom:0px;left:0px;z-index:10;}
.xdlas a{font-size:18px;line-height:50px;display: block;color:#fff;overflow: hidden; white-space: nowrap; text-overflow: ellipsis;width: 80%;margin:0 auto;}
.xdr{float:right;width:640px;}
.xdr li{display: block;width: 100%;background:#FFFAF1;height:60px;margin-bottom:10px;}
.xdr li i{display: block;float:left;width:3px;height:20px;background:#D31C20;margin-top:20px;margin-left:10px;margin-bottom:20px;}
.xdr li a{display: block;color:#333333;font-size:18px;float:right;line-height:60px;overflow: hidden; white-space: nowrap; text-overflow: ellipsis;width:617px;}
.jh{width:1280px;margin:0 auto;margini-top:10px;}
.jhl{width:612px;}
.jhts{width:100%;height:60px;border-bottom:3px solid #FF2622;position: relative;margin-top:30px;}
.jhts a{display: block;font-size:30px;color:#FF2622;line-height:60px;width:130px;font-weight:bold;border-bottom:5px solid #FFD99A;position: absolute;text-align:center;left:0px;bottom:-4px;}
.jhl ul{margin-top:20px;}
.jhl ul li{display: block;width: 100%;background:url(./lunsj.png) no-repeat left center;}
.jhl ul li a{font-size:18px;color:#333333;line-height:300%;display:block;width:90%;padding-left: 13px;
			overflow: hidden; white-space: nowrap; text-overflow: ellipsis;transition:all 0.4s ease;
	-o-transition:all 0.4s ease;
	-ms-transition:all 0.4s ease;
	-moz-transition:all 0.4s ease;
	-webkit-transition:all 0.4s ease;}
	.jba a{width:80px;}
	#jzdtb{width:100%;background:#FFF1E2;margin-top:50px;padding-top:50px;padding-bottom:70px;}
	.jzdtli{width:1280px;margin:0 auto;margin-top:10px;}
	.llxx{width:630px;background:#fff;padding-bottom:30px;border-top-left-radius: 30px;}
	.jhtss{width:100%;height:60px;border-bottom:3px solid #FF2622;position: relative;margin-top:30px;}
	.jhtss a{display: block;font-size:30px;color:#FF2622;line-height:60px;width:130px;font-weight:bold;border-bottom:5px solid #FFD99A;position: absolute;text-align:center;left:250px;bottom:-4px;}
	.llxx ul{margin-top:20px;}
	.llxx ul li{display: block;width: 100%;background:url(./lunsj.png) no-repeat 20px center;}
	.llxx ul li a{font-size:18px;color:#333333;line-height:300%;display:block;width:90%;padding-left: 40px;
				overflow: hidden; white-space: nowrap; text-overflow: ellipsis;transition:all 0.4s ease;
		-o-transition:all 0.4s ease;
		-ms-transition:all 0.4s ease;
		-moz-transition:all 0.4s ease;
		-webkit-transition:all 0.4s ease;}
		
		.tfli{width:415px;float:left;background:#fff;padding-bottom:30px;}
		
		.tfhtss{width:100%;height:60px;border-bottom:1px solid #FF2622;position: relative;margin-top:30px;}
			.tfhtss a{display: block;font-size:30px;color:#FF2622;line-height:60px;width:130px;font-weight:bold;border-bottom:3px solid #FFD99A;position: absolute;text-align:center;left:15px;bottom:-2px;}

.tfli ul{margin-top:20px;}
	.tfli ul li{display: block;width: 100%;background:url(./lunsj.png) no-repeat 20px center;}
	.tfli ul li a{font-size:18px;color:#333333;line-height:300%;display:block;width:85%;padding-left: 40px;
				overflow: hidden; white-space: nowrap; text-overflow: ellipsis;transition:all 0.4s ease;
		-o-transition:all 0.4s ease;
		-ms-transition:all 0.4s ease;
		-moz-transition:all 0.4s ease;
		-webkit-transition:all 0.4s ease;}

#acfvgtre a{display: block;font-size: 30px;line-height: 60px;width: 130px;font-weight: bold;text-align: center;float:left;margin-left:90px;}
.llxxulshowli ul{margin-top:20px;width:600px;}
.llxxulshowli ul li{display: block;width: 100%;background:url(./lunsj.png) no-repeat left center;}
.llxxulshowli ul li a{
font-size:18px;color:#333333;line-height:300%;display:block;width:90%;padding-left: 13px;
			overflow: hidden; white-space: nowrap; text-overflow: ellipsis;transition:all 0.4s ease;
	-o-transition:all 0.4s ease;
	-ms-transition:all 0.4s ease;
	-moz-transition:all 0.4s ease;
	-webkit-transition:all 0.4s ease;}
.lshowulefy{float:left;margin-left:30px;}
.lshowurighy{float:right;}